SHELTER KIT – Sleeping cabin as a retreat for residents of emergency shelters
A lack of privacy, permanent noise pollution, and a lack of retreat options characterize the everyday life of many people in refugee and emergency shelters. Especially in large collective accommodations, cramped living conditions and open room structures make recovery, sleep, and personal moments of retreat difficult.
The bachelor thesis examines the possibilities of ready-made design in a social context. The result is the “Shelter Kit” – a modular sleeping and retreat system made of standardized, cost-effective materials.
Wooden panels, HT pipes, and flame-retardant textile elements are combined to form a sleeping cabin that creates privacy and reduces light and noise influences. The project shows how the recombination of existing components with simple means can make concrete improvements within existing emergency shelters possible.
